Cruachan Visitor Centre is set within an idyllic location on the shores of Loch Awe, the Visitor Centre is perfect for a great day out. Our exciting exhibition shows how the power station works, with lots of information of renewable electricity. There are interactive touchscreens, displays of old memorabilia and a working model of a turbine generator.
Guided Tours take you deep inside the Hollow Mountain, where you will see the mighty Machine Hall, and our experienced guides will tell you about the Power Station, from its history and construction to how it works and its current role generating up to 440MW at times of peak demand on the National Grid. The Guided Tour lasts approximately 30 minutes. Booking is recommended.
Our tours are unfortunately not suitable for wheelchair users and may be unsuitable for persons with limited mobility or a need for weight bearing walking aids (frames, crutches etc) as the route requires tour participants to walk along an up-hill walk-way with a number of steps. We are not able to offer lift access to the Visitor Gallery inside the cavern.
